You write custom CUDA kernels to replace the pytorch operators in the given architecture to get speedups.
|
||||
|
||||
You have complete freedom to choose the set of operators you want to replace. You may make the decision to replace some operators with custom CUDA kernels and leave others unchanged. You may replace multiple operators with custom implementations, consider operator fusion opportunities (combining multiple operators into a single kernel, for example, combining matmul+relu), or algorithmic changes (such as online softmax). You are only limited by your imagination.

@ -0,0 +1,73 @@
|
|||
import torch
|
||||
import torch.nn as nn
|
||||
from torch.utils.cpp_extension import load_inline
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
cpp_src = "torch::Tensor vandermonde_cuda(torch::Tensor x, int N);"
|
||||
|
||||
cuda_src = """
|
||||
#include <cuda_runtime.h>
|
||||
|
||||
__global__ void vander_kernel(
|
||||
const float* __restrict__ x_ptr,
|
||||
float* __restrict__ output,
|
||||
int num_points,
|
||||
int N // Degree (Columns)
|
||||
) {
|
||||
int idx = blockIdx.x * blockDim.x + threadIdx.x;
|
||||
if (idx >= num_points) return;
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
float val = x_ptr[idx];
|
||||
|
||||
int row_offset = idx * N;
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
float current_pow = 1.0f;
|
||||
|
||||
for (int i = N - 1; i >= 0; --i) {
|
||||
output[row_offset + i] = current_pow;
|
||||
current_pow *= val;
|
||||
}
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
torch::Tensor vandermonde_cuda(torch::Tensor x, int N) {
|
||||
int num_points = x.size(0);
|
||||
x = x.contiguous();
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
auto output = torch::empty({num_points, N}, x.options());
|
||||
|
||||
const int block_size = 256;
|
||||
int grid_size = (num_points + block_size - 1) / block_size;
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
if (grid_size > 2147483647) grid_size = 2147483647;
|
||||
|
||||
vander_kernel<<<grid_size, block_size>>>(
|
||||
x.data_ptr<float>(),
|
||||
output.data_ptr<float>(),
|
||||
num_points,
|
||||
N
|
||||
);
|
||||
|
||||
return output;
|
||||
}
|
||||
"""
|
||||
|
||||
class ModelNew(nn.Module):
|
||||
def __init__(self, N=64):
|
||||
super().__init__()
|
||||
self.N = N
|
||||
self.module = load_inline(
|
||||
name="vandermonde_matrix_opt_v1",
|
||||
cpp_sources=cpp_src,
|
||||
cuda_sources=cuda_src,
|
||||
functions=["vandermonde_cuda"],
|
||||
verbose=False,
|
||||
extra_cuda_cflags=["-O3"]
|
||||
)
|
||||
|
||||
def forward(self, x):
|
||||
return self.module.vandermonde_cuda(x, self.N)
